Elixir Tonics & Treats

About Elixir Tonics & Treats

Drinks for the inner thirst.

More about Elixir Tonics & Treats

Elixir Tonics & Treats is located at 123 Deansgate, M32BY Manchester, United Kingdom
01612228588
http://www.Elixir-Manchester.co.uk Info@elixir-manchester.co.uk